Steps to Take Before Hiring a Divorce Lawyer

Preparation is key. Before consulting with a divorce lawyer, gather important information:

  • Financial documents, including tax returns, bank statements, and debts
  • Property deeds, vehicle titles, and investment records
  • Marriage certificate and any prior legal agreements
  • Child custody or support records, if applicable

Providing these documents helps your lawyer evaluate your case and plan a strategy effectively.

The Divorce Process in Tennessee

While every divorce case is unique, most cases follow a similar process:

  1. Filing for Divorce: One spouse files a petition with the court.
  2. Temporary Orders: Courts may issue temporary custody, support, or property orders.
  3. Negotiation & Mediation: Lawyers work to resolve disputes outside of court.
  4. Discovery: Both parties exchange financial and personal information.
  5. Trial (if necessary): A judge makes the final decisions if disputes remain unresolved.
  6. Final Divorce Decree: Court issues orders regarding custody, support, and property division.

Affordable Divorce Options

Many people assume divorce lawyer tennessee are expensive, but there are affordable options available in Tennessee. Some lawyers offer flat fees, limited-scope representation, or payment plans. Additionally, mediation and uncontested divorce options can significantly reduce costs.
